I'll post to the list and BCC you. > What you want to do instead is use the long form with get_logger(): > package Helper; > use Log::Log4perl qw(get_logger); > Log::Log4perl->wrapper_register(__PACKAGE__); > sub help { get_logger()->debug(__FILE__, "-", __LINE__, ' ', @_) } That solves both %c and 'category' -- thanks! The 'category' filtering will be very useful. :-) I'm not certain if %T is doing the right thing (?). You said there might be a bug. Do you mean that the: ... Helper::help(...) called at ... stances should be ... Log::Log4perl::__ANON__(...) called at ... ? It's not a burning issue for me; I can use the output as is.
